Output 28abeba078eb359008d7f324f31841e5d8a1528be924b5482815236f6373dc13:20

value
51588
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 129362fcc1377fc6a25cadffa977e274ca013d7800dafd3b3f0c0a91b1adbdbf
address
bc1pz2fk9lxpxaludgju4hl6jalzwn9qz0tcqrd06welps9frvddhklspeqltg
transaction
28abeba078eb359008d7f324f31841e5d8a1528be924b5482815236f6373dc13